Detection and Repair of Water Leak in Restroom


Water leak in washroom generally arises from plumbing and pipeline mistakes. There are a number of kinds of bathroom leakages. You might require a fundamental knowledge of these leakage kinds to spot the water leakage in restroom. Below are the typical restroom leakages as well as fix pointers:

Clogged Shower Room Sinks


Often, the water leakage in shower room results from sink obstructions. This is commonly a problem to home owners and may be undesirable. Clogs might result from the build-up of soap scum, hair fragments, or debris that clog the drainpipe. It is very easy to handle obstructions, and you may not require professional skills.

What to Do


You can use a drainpipe snake to get rid of the debris in the drainpipe and let the stationary water circulation. Drain cleansers are additionally offered in stores as well as are easy to use. A bettor is also useful in removing your drain. It is a typical household tool as well as can be found in handy in removing frustrating clogs in sinks as well as drains.

Toilet Leaks


Often, water leaks from the toilet and swimming pools around the commode base. It is an eye sore in the washroom and also requires timely focus.

What to Do


If there hang screws between the tank and commode, you just require to tighten them. In some cases you may require to reapply wax on the gasket or call in a bathroom leakage expert to change used or damaged components.

Splash Leaks


These typically arise from water splashing on the shower room floor from the tub. It is a consequence of using a poor shower drape or worn bath tub lining. It harms the washroom flooring as well as may trigger rot to wood floors and also washroom doors. The water typically swimming pools around the bathtub or shower. This might result in even worse bathroom damage without timely handling.

What to Do


If the leakage has harmed the washroom floor or door, you may require to change these to protect against further damage. The excellent news is that you can include a pipes specialist to help with the shower room repair.

Water Leaking in the Bathroom Wall


A GUIDE TO FINDING LEAKS IN BATHROOM WALLS


  • Paint or Wallpaper Peeling: This sign is easily spotted, so it cannot be missed. A leak in the wall can lead to wallpaper that separates along seams or paint that bubbles or flakes off the walls.


  • Musty Smells: The damp flooring and plaster inside the wall grow an odor similar to wet cardboard as water slowly drips from a leaky pipe inside the wall. You can find leaks hidden beneath a musty odor.


  • Growing Stains: The interior of a wall affected by a leaky pipe sometimes becomes infested with mold. Often, your indicator of a hidden plumbing problem is a growing strain on otherwise clean plaster.


  • Structural Damage: Do not overlook constant moisture inside the walls of bathrooms when ceilings or floors become structurally compromised. Water-damaged walls can damage adjacent surfaces and stain flooring and ceilings.


  • Unusual Discoloration: The wet spots may eventually dry when a leak penetrates deeper inside a wall. The stains they leave behind are paler than the adjacent paint or surface.


  • Dripping Sound: It is common to hear dripping sounds inside walls when water runs down them. A squeaking noise can be heard while turning off a valve in a sink, bathtub, or shower. When flushing the toilet, you may also hear this noise.


  • A GUIDE TO REPAIRING WATER LEAKAGE




  • Verify The Wall Leak: Shut down your main water supply and note the reading on your water meter. If the meter reading rises after a few hours, the leak is inside the house. In the absence of any changes, the leak may be the result of clogged gutters or drains.


  • Turn off the water: You can turn off the water after you confirm the leak is within the walls. If you’re beginning repairs, drain as much water from the pipes as possible.


  • Find & Fix The Leakage: Locate the wettest area on the wall with a moisture meter or infrared camera. Patch kits can stop the leak, but the fix might only be short-term. In the next few days, double-check the area to ensure the leak is no longer present.


  • Removing mold and cleaning all surfaces: Dish soap and warm water should be used to clean affected areas. Bleach and water are recommended for disinfecting nonporous surfaces. Fan and dehumidifier running will speed up drying time. Remove mold growth immediately from walls, ceilings, and other surfaces.
